No Gloating, Please!


by JohnHuang2


I admit it's tempting, deliciously tempting, especially after a grueling campaign as this, but I won't. Instead, I'm going to be magnanimous. In other words, if you're looking for gloating, you're looking in the wrong place. From published reports, I gather the White House has adopted a similar No-Gloat approach, and I think that's a good thing. Some of you might not agree -- what's wrong with a little gloating? -- but I think we've got to be bigger than that. In short,
stay above-the-fray.
That's why you won't hear a peep from me about Bush's victory Tuesday, not a word on how Bush successfully beat back challenger John Kerry. That's according to a poll of over 110 million registered voters conducted Tuesday. The Democrats' inability to unseat the President -- despite having poured unprecedented amounts of money and manpower in their hopeless effort to topple the wartime leader -- must be quite a bitter pill to swallow. But, as I said, nary a word about it from me.
Here's what else my lips are sealed -- tightly sealed -- about: President Bush's very long coattails. On Tuesday, Republicans expanded their majority in Congress to 233 House seats, keeping the chamber in GOP hands for the sixth straight election. As for the Senate, more good news (which I refuse to mention). The GOP swept all five Democrat Southern seats -- South Carolina, North Carolina, Louisiana, Florida, and Georgia, crippling Democrats for years to come, but I'm not gonna gloat about that either.
I suppose I could gloat about the stunning Senate upset in South Dakota (but I won't). Not since Barry Goldwater's famed 1952 victory over Ernest McFarland had a Senate leader been toppled. Tom Daschle got his walking papers Tuesday, losing his bid for a fourth term to former GOP Congressman John Thune, but -- again -- you won't hear me gloat about it, or even mention it once. My lips are totally sealed.
Look at it this way: If I were gloating, wouldn't I mention how Bush is the first President in 16 years to win a majority of the popular vote? Wouldn't I be pointing out that Bush got nearly 4 million more votes than Kerry nation-wide? Clinton never got a majority of the popular vote, garnering just 43% in '92 and 49% in '96. Indeed, Bush got more votes than Clinton ever dreamed of getting. Of course I haven't mentioned any of this, nor will I; this is no time to gloat.

Oh, remember the torrent of media stories that angry voters in Florida, bent on revenge for 2000, were champing at the bit to even the score in 2004? Needless to say, there was little evidence of it Tuesday, much to media chagrin -- but I'm not gonna mention that either.
And if you thought I'd gloat about how wrong exit polling was Tuesday, you're mistaken. In fact, I won't even mention how an early batch had Bush losing in Florida, Ohio, North Carolina, you name it. I haven't gloated to date, and I'm not about to start now.
Oh, one more thing...
Congratulations, Mr. President!!! ;-)
And God bless the United States of America.
Anyway, that's...
My two cents
